    Overview
    IBM Tivoli Access Manager is a robust and secure centralized policy management solution for e-business and distributed applications. IBM Tivoli Access Manager WebSEAL is a high performance, multi-threaded Web server that applies fine-grained security policy to the Tivoli Access Manager protected Web object space. WebSEAL can provide single sign-on solutions and incorporate back-end Web application server resources into its security policy.

    Sign&go is a modular global SSO solution from llex International which addresses the security and traceability issues. It offers Strong authentication, Web Access Management, Mobile Access Management, Identity Federation functionalities through common architecture and administration.
